2. Moisture
Water can lead to serious damage. Excess humidity promotes mold growth, which deteriorates your doll’s materials over time. Keep your doll in a dry environment.
3. Direct Sunlight
UV rays can fade colors and weaken the structure of your doll. Avoid setting your doll in direct sunlight for extended periods.
4. Sharp Objects
Accidental contact with sharp items can cause tears or cuts. Store your doll safely away from clutter and sharp edges.

Frequently Asked Questions
What temperature is safe for my doll?
A safe temperature is generally below 75°F (24°C) to prevent warping or damage.
How can I prevent moisture damage?
Use dehumidifiers in damp areas and keep your doll in a well-ventilated room.
Are there specific types of cleaners I should avoid?
Avoid bleach and alcohol-based cleaners, as they can harm the doll’s surface.
